How Odds Work
Before we can fully appreciate Fortnite odds, it’s essential first to understand how odds work in betting scenarios. Betting odds represent the probability of an event occurring. They dictate the payout for a winning bet, which is determined by the stake, or the amount bet.
Odds can be represented in different ways, but the most common formats are fractional, decimal, and American odds. No matter the format, the fundamental principle remains the same: odds reflect the likelihood of a certain outcome.

Understanding Fortnite Betting Odds
Fortnite betting odds function just like odds in any other sport. Bookmakers set these odds based on various factors, such as each competitor’s past performance, current form, and public opinion. Punters then place their bets based on these odds, which also dictate potential payout.
Understanding Fortnite betting odds can seem overwhelming, especially when looking at different odds formats. But don’t worry, we’re here to break it down for you:
Decimal Odds
Popular in most of Europe, Canada, and Australia, decimal odds are arguably the simplest to understand. The potential return from a bet (stake * odds), including the stake, is what the odds represent.
For instance, let’s say the odds for a player to win a Fortnite match are 1.75. If you stake $10, you stand to win $17.50 if your bet is successful.
Fractional Odds
Common in the UK and Ireland, fractional odds show potential profit relative to the stake. For instance, odds of 4/1 (read “four-to-one”) mean that you stand to profit four times your stake if your bet wins.
American Odds
American odds, also known as moneyline odds, are popular in the United States. A positive number indicates how much profit you stand to make on a $100 stake, while a negative number indicates how much you need to stake to make a $100 profit.

Fortnite Streamers Odds
Esports betting has significantly evolved since its inception, with Fortnite at the center of this innovation. Twitch, the leading live streaming platform for gamers, has introduced a whole new element to the betting scene: Fortnite streamer odds.
What Are Fortnite Streamer Odds?
Streamer odds are a fresh addition to the esports gambling ecosystem. They represent the probability of a specific outcome happening related to a Twitch streamer’s Fortnite game performance. These could include a range of events, such as the number of kills a streamer will make in a match, whether they will win or lose, or even more specific events like how many headshots they will land.
How Do Twitch Streamer Odds Work?
Twitch streamer odds work similarly to traditional sports betting odds. They reflect the perceived likelihood of a certain event happening. For instance, a streamer with low odds for a victory is considered more likely to win than a streamer with high odds. Conversely, high odds indicate that the bookmaker believes the event is less likely to happen, but if it does, the payout will be larger.
